A new Jordan Hashemite Charity Organization (JHCO) humanitarian aid convoy, consisting of 45 trucks, arrived in the Gaza Strip on the eve of Eid Al-Adha.

The convoy, organized by the Jordanian Armed Forces - the Arab Army and JHCO, was supported by several organizations, companies, and institutions.

The convoy carried essential food parcels and flour, which will be distributed to the people of Gaza through partner associations and organizations within the sector. This initiative comes as a critical lifeline for many families in Gaza, particularly during the festive period of Eid Al-Adha.

Hussein Shibli, Secretary-General of JHCO, stated, "We strive to continue the delivery of aid, which we receive from various countries, organizations, institutions, and humanitarian agencies.”

He further explained that, to date, the total number of land trucks that have entered the Gaza Strip is 1,970, along with 53 planes via Arish.
